Hotel Zoo Berlin is a 5-star boutique hotel sitting directly on Kurfürstendamm, Berlin's grandest shopping boulevard. Built in 1891 as a private residence by Prussian architect Alfred Messel and converted to a hotel in 1911, it hosted Marlene Dietrich, Grace Kelly, and Sophia Loren during its Berlinale heyday before closing for a full gut renovation in 2012. American interior designer Dayna Lee (Powerstrip Studio, NY/LA) reopened it in 2014 with exposed original brick walls, soaring ceilings, bespoke furniture, and a 22-metre jade-green leopard-print entrance carpet designed by Diane von Furstenberg — equal parts Berlin heritage and New York townhouse glamour.

The hotel displays a commissioned photography series by Swedish photographer Andreas Kock, shot in the hotel's original rooms just before the 2012 closure. The idea came from Dayna Lee — scenes from the pre-renovation hotel preserved in black and white. Artwork is integrated throughout corridors and public spaces.
